Latest Patents
Shimo's latest patents include a method for producing sodium ferrite particle powder. This invention is characterized by the inclusion of at least one metal from a specific group, such as silicon, aluminum, and titanium, in a precise weight percentage. The molar ratio of sodium to iron is maintained between 0.75 and 1.25, enhancing the material's properties. Another notable patent involves the creation of aniline black that is free from harmful substances like chromium and copper. This aniline black exhibits excellent blackness and high resistivity, making it suitable for various applications. The invention also includes a black resin composition and dispersions that utilize this aniline black, ensuring excellent dispersibility.
